Hawkins Post Office 1889-1906

by Terry E. Wantz
 
Hawkins Post Office was established on Nov. 13th., 1889. The office was named after George Hawkins who had a general store at the corner of Section 2,3,10 and 11 of Barton Township. The office was located in his store and he was the first Postmaster. The settlement around the store became known as Hawkins On. Oct. 12th., 1891, William L. Remington became the Postmaster. He had a store across the road from George Hawkins. The office was discontinued April 14th., 1906, with the mail going to Reed City Post Office in Osceola County.
